calculate the pressure due to height 110m take g=10m/s density of water = 103kg m-3

Given:

Height (h) = 110 m

Accelration due to gravity (g) = 10 m/s²

Density of water (ρ) = 10³ kg/m³

To Find:

Pressure (P)

Answer:

Pressure at vertical depth:

 \boxed{ \bf{P =  \rho gh}}

By substituting values we get:

  \rm \implies P =   {10}^{3}  \times 10 \times 110 \\  \\   \rm \implies P =  1.1 \times  {10}^{6}  \: Pa \\  \\   \rm \implies P =  1.1  \: MPa

 \therefore  \boxed{\mathfrak{Pressure \ (P) = 1.1 \ MPa}}
